About [3-[(3-chloro-4-pyridinyl)oxy]piperidin-1-yl]-(4-methyl-1,3-thiazol-5-yl)methanone
[3-[(3-chloro-4-pyridinyl)oxy]piperidin-1-yl]-(4-methyl-1,3-thiazol-5-yl)methanone (PubChem CID 122256393) has the molecular formula C15H16ClN3O2S
and a molecular weight of 337.83 g/mol. Its IUPAC name is [3-[(3-chloro-4-pyridinyl)oxy]piperidin-1-yl]-(4-methyl-1,3-thiazol-5-yl)methanone.

What is the SMILES notation for [3-[(3-chloro-4-pyridinyl)oxy]piperidin-1-yl]-(4-methyl-1,3-thiazol-5-yl)methanone?
The canonical SMILES for [3-[(3-chloro-4-pyridinyl)oxy]piperidin-1-yl]-(4-methyl-1,3-thiazol-5-yl)methanone is Cc1ncsc1C(=O)N1CCCC(Oc2ccncc2Cl)C1.
What is the InChIKey of [3-[(3-chloro-4-pyridinyl)oxy]piperidin-1-yl]-(4-methyl-1,3-thiazol-5-yl)methanone?
The InChIKey is HRHASBFVJOBPRB-UHFFFAOYSA-N. The full InChI is InChI=1S/C15H16ClN3O2S/c1-10-14(22-9-18-10)15(20)19-6-2-3-11(8-19)21-13-4-5-17-7-12(13)16/h4-5,7,9,11H,2-3,6,8H2,1H3.
What are the key properties of [3-[(3-chloro-4-pyridinyl)oxy]piperidin-1-yl]-(4-methyl-1,3-thiazol-5-yl)methanone?
[3-[(3-chloro-4-pyridinyl)oxy]piperidin-1-yl]-(4-methyl-1,3-thiazol-5-yl)methanone has a molecular weight of 337.83 g/mol, XLogP of 3.18, 3 rotatable bonds, 0 hydrogen bond donors, and 5 hydrogen bond acceptors.
